A Day in the Life of Nursery at Red House School

What does a typical day look like in Nursery at Red House School? Full of smiles, discovery, and meaningful learning, every day is carefully structured to support children’s development while ensuring plenty of fun. From wellbeing activities to outdoor exploration, our Nursery pupils enjoy a rich and engaging Early Years experience.

A Warm Welcome to Start the Day

Each morning begins with happy smiles and a warm welcome at registration. This calm and positive start helps children feel settled, confident, and ready for the exciting day ahead.

Wellbeing Wednesday and Emotional Development

Supporting children’s emotional growth is at the heart of our Nursery curriculum. Through our Wellbeing Wednesday sessions, pupils build emotional literacy and learn strategies to understand and manage their feelings – an essential foundation for lifelong wellbeing.

Outdoor Learning and Exploration

Outdoor time is a key part of the Nursery day. Children explore nature, develop physical skills, and engage their curiosity through hands-on experiences in the fresh air. Outdoor learning encourages creativity, independence, and a love of the natural world.

Healthy Snack Time for Growing Minds

Snack time provides a chance to refuel with healthy options, supporting children’s energy levels and promoting good eating habits. It’s also a valuable social moment where children practice communication and independence.

Play and Social Time with Reception Friends

Play is central to early learning. Our Nursery pupils enjoy playtime with Reception children, helping to build friendships, confidence, and important social skills in a fun and relaxed environment.

Circle Time: Communication and Confidence

During circle time, children come together to share stories, ideas, and exciting news. This daily activity develops speaking and listening skills while nurturing confidence and a sense of belonging.

Lunchtime Together

Lunchtime is a special part of the day, where children enjoy a delicious meal together with Mr Barnbrook-McKay in a friendly and supportive setting. It’s another opportunity to build independence and social skills.

Choosing Time and Child-Led Learning

Choosing time allows children to follow their interests and engage in carefully planned activities. This balance of structured learning and child-led exploration supports creativity, decision-making, and deeper engagement.

Active PE Sessions

Physical activity is essential for young learners. Nursery pupils enjoy energetic PE sessions with Miss Cummings  that build coordination, confidence, and teamwork—all while having lots of fun.

Story Time and a Calm End to the Day

The day winds down with story time, where children share favourite books and discover new stories. This calming routine supports language development and fosters a love of reading.

A Happy Home Time

After a full and enriching day, children head home happy, confident, and excited to return for another day of learning and fun in Nursery.
